Location and Surroundings


Webster & Woods North Park sits just north of Walnut Hill Lane and east of US-75 (Central Expressway), making it highly accessible for commuters and those who frequent Dallas’ core business and entertainment districts. The neighborhood is bordered by tree-lined residential streets, with Royal Lane and Park Lane serving as key east-west connectors. This central placement allows residents to reach Downtown Dallas, the Park Cities, and Richardson with relative ease.

One of the standout features of this area is its proximity to NorthPark Center, a major shopping and dining destination just a few minutes away by car. Residents also benefit from quick access to the White Rock Creek Trail system and several local parks, giving them options for outdoor recreation without leaving the neighborhood. Public transportation options are available along the nearby expressways, but most locals rely on personal vehicles to get around.

Homes in Webster & Woods North Park

The housing stock in Webster & Woods North Park primarily consists of single-story ranch homes and two-story traditional properties, many of which were built between the 1960s and 1980s. These homes typically sit on generous lots with mature landscaping, offering both privacy and room for outdoor living. Brick exteriors, large windows, and attached garages are common features, reflecting the architectural preferences of the era.

Over the years, some properties have undergone thoughtful renovations, blending original details with modern updates. It’s not unusual to find homes with updated kitchens, open floor plans, and enhanced outdoor spaces, while others retain their vintage charm. The neighborhood’s established tree canopy and consistent lot sizes create a cohesive streetscape that stands out from newer developments in North Dallas.
